OUR WORK
With the aim of encouraging women in the ward to move forward through entrepreneurship and become self-employed, free auto-rickshaw training was provided to women along with the distribution of auto-rickshaws.




A felicitation ceremony for meritorious students who have passed the 10th and 12th grade examinations in the ward is organized every year.
With the support of Hon. Deputy Chief Minister Shri Eknathji Shinde Saheb, a free ST bus service is provided every year during Ganeshotsav for Konkan-bound migrant workers.
On the occasion of International Women’s Day, meritorious women from the ward are honored every year, and various games are organized to provide a platform for women to showcase their talents.


With the aim of spreading the history of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j to as many Shiv devotees as possible, a “Fort Model Making” competition is organized every year on the occasion of Diwali. Participating contestants are taken to a fort each year, where the prize distribution ceremony is held. In the year 2025–26, this program was celebrated with great enthusiasm at Raigad Fort.

With the aim of encouraging women to move forward through entrepreneurship and progress toward industry, a “Diwali Market” was organized for women’s self-help groups.




Under the Chief Minister’s Employment Generation Program, commercial vehicles and mobile vending center vehicles were distributed to educated unemployed youth in the ward.
Free health check-up camps were organized for the citizens of the ward during the COVID period.
“Self-defense training classes aimed at boosting confidence for the safety of women and children were organized.”


The popular initiative “Anandpath – Jatra Arogya” is organized every year in the Pachpakhadi area especially for the health and well-being of citizens. It includes activities such as sword fighting, stick fighting (lathi-kathi), yoga, skating, Zumba, Mallakhamb, gymnastics, cycling, Langdi, Bharatanatyam, laughter club, Attya-Patya, and many other activities.
“To ensure the well-being of citizens, a free and comprehensive health check-up was organized for everyone in the ward.”
